Chapter 134: Life 66, Age 20, Martial Master 1
We stepped out onto a solid stone platform. Immediately a middle-aged-looking man approached us.
“Academy students?”
“Ye… Yes,” I said, slightly disoriented from the change in scenery.
We had moved from the middle of a bustling city to the outskirts of a small village surrounded by craggy, rocky hills. Instead of the city’s wide array of eclectic buildings, the village only had a few small stone huts.
The majestic Dragon Peak which had soared above the clouds had disappeared. The bounty of colors from its various features, such as the reds and greens from trees and shrubs to the blues and grays from creeks and rivers, were no more. It had all been replaced by a dull brown solid stone mountain that looked rather squat by comparison.
“Please come with me.” The middle-aged man gestured at one of the nearby stone huts.
Bewildered by our new surroundings, the three of us didn’t move.
“Is this the Earth Peak?” asked Shi YuLong. “Where are all the people?”
“Yes, it is,” the man confirmed. “Let’s get you registered first. Once that is taken care of, I can share a bit of information about the peak on our way to the Trial.”
